Yes, you can definitely appear in NDA -2, even if you haven't appeared in NDA-1 provided you fulfill its eligibility criteria given below:-
-------------) Qualification required :-
For army :- you need educational qualification of 10 + 2 in any stream.
For navy and Airforce :- To need qualifucation of 10 + 2 with Physics and Maths .
††12th board examination appearing students are also provisionally eligible .

>>>>> Selection process is given below:-
The selection process consist of 2 stages :-
******** Qualify the written examination :- it consist of 2 papers :-
Mathematics
General Ability Test
You get 2 hours and 30 minutes for each paper.
********SSB interview :- If you clear written examination then you will called for a 5 day SSB interview
If you clear SSB interview then you will have you to go through medicals to check your fitness if you clear the medicals as well then congratulations you are in.

For your reference the complete eligibility criteria for NDA is mentioned below :-
>>> Either you should be an Indian National or a subject of Nepal or a subject of Bhutan or people of Indian origin migrated from Zaire, Ethiopia, East African Countries of Kenya, the United Republic of Tanzania, Malawi, Uganda, Burma, Pakistan, Zambia, Sri Lanka and Vietnam to settle in India or Tibetan refugees came to India, to settle in India before January 1, 1962
>>> For NDA 1 2023 the age should be 16.5-19.5 years old and should have born in between July 2, 2004 to July 1, 2007.
>>> Indian Army - Should have passed 12th standard from valid State Education Board or a University.
>>> Indian Air Force and Naval - Should have passed 12th standard with Physics and Mathematics from valid State Education Board or a University.
>>> The candidate should be unmarried.

As per your query I would like to inform you that if one of your eyesight is weak you can definitely give NDA but you won't be eligible to join Indian Airforce. In order to join Indian Airforce your vision for both the eyes should be 6/6. Since your eyesight is weak can go for Indian Army or Indian Navy provided your vision ranges from -2.5D to 3.5D.
You can also go for laser surgery to treat your eyesight and you are good to join any of the forces.

Hope you are doing great. Only a full-time, residential undergraduate programme is available at the NDA. After three years of study, cadets get a Baccalaureate degree. Cadets can choose between two academic tracks.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ics, and Computer Science are all available under the Science stream.
Whatever degree you choose, you will be trained as army cadets and receive the same wages, with certain allowance variations according on your cadet/place of assignment.
